Terms of Reference Access Advisory Committee

 

Access Advisory Committee

TERMS OF REFERENCE

June 2009

 

These Terms of Reference are to be read in conjunction with Parramatta City Council Advisory Committees Core Terms of Reference (2009)

 

 

1.         Primary Purpose

1.1       The Access Advisory Committee’s purpose is to advise Council on the access needs of people with physical disabilities and access issues associated with intellectual, sensory, aural, visual and psychological challenges

 

1.2       To provide advice, input and feedback in Parramatta City Council’s business relating to people with physical disabilities and access issues associated with intellectual, sensory, aural, visual and psychological challenges within the parameters of PCC authority and responsibilities  

 

2.         Roles and Responsibilities

2.1       To provide specialist advice to Council relating to access issues

 

2.2       To provide a forum for community members and organisations to raise and address access issues and needs

 

2.3       To report back to individuals, organisations and networks on Council’s role and responsibilities and its decisions relating to the Access Advisory Committee

 

2.4       Provide advice for and monitor the implementation of relevant Council planning programs and policies in relation to the Disability Discrimination Act 1992

 

2.5       Deliver community programs to address the needs of and/or celebrate people with a disability

 

3.         Membership Criteria

Applicants must meet at least one of the following criterion:

 

3.1 People with a disability who live, work or study in Parramatta LGA

           

3.2 People employed by a disability service provider in the Parramatta LGA

 

3.3 People with a demonstrated qualification/ competency/ knowledge of legislative requirements such as the Disability Discrimination Act 1992

 

NB: The Selection Panel will take into account the need for representation from people with different disabilities on the Access Advisory Committee

 

4.         Frequency of Meetings

4.1      The Committee will meet bi-monthly, on the third Tuesday of every even month, or at other times as the Committee determines
